The Bar Council of India has concluded the application process for the AIBE 20 on its official website. The candidates registered for the AIBE XX (20) exam will now be able to edit their application forms and pay the fee until 01-Nov-2025. Check what next for AIBE 20 exam.

AIBE 20 Application Form Correction and Fee Payment

The Bar Council of India will conduct the AIBE 20 exam on 30-Nov-2025. The application process for the AIBE 20 exam started on the official website, the last date for which was 31-Oct-2025. However, the BCI allows the candidates to edit their forms by visiting the official website; i.e. allindiabarexamination.com. The candidates can also make the fee payment until 01-Nov-2025. The eligibiltiy criteria for the AIBE exam is passing the three-year LLB or five-year LLB degree. The BCI will issue the Certificate of Practice (CoP) to the successful candidates.

How to Make Corrections in the AIBE 20 (XX) Application Form?

Candidates can edit the AIBE application by following the pointers below,

  • Visit the AIBE official website
  • Now click on the registration portal and log in
  • On the new page, navigate for the category you want to edit
  • Make the required changes
  • Save the changes and re-submit the AIBE 2025 Application Form
Q:   Is it mandatory to get registered with the same state bar council where I have graduated from?
A:
Key points related to State Bar Council Enrolment are: It is mandatory for candidates to get enrolled with a state bar council for filling the AIBE application form 3-year and 5-year LL.B. Graduates can get enrolled with state bar councils Some state bar councils conduct an online enrollment process, while in some states the candidate needs to visit the bar council office in person and collect the enrollment form. In case the candidate has passed the 3-year or 5-year LL.B. Programme before 2009-2010, they are not required to qualify the AIBE exam to practice in a court of law.
